Callaway Golf Faces Backlash Over Controversial Advertisement

Neutral Summary

Callaway Golf came under fire after a controversial advertisement featuring the Good Good brand showed a woman being shoved, sparking widespread criticism. The company acknowledged it had approved the ad and announced internal and external investigations. The CEO issued a public apology, admitting 'mistakes were made.'

RightFox News

Callaway admits it approved controversial Good Good woman-shoving ad in late-night statement

Callaway CEO Chip Brewer acknowledged in a late-night statement that the company had approved an advertisement featuring Good Good golfer Garrett Clark shoving a woman prior to its online release. The ad sparked controversy after it was posted publicly.
